Step-by-Step Guide to Cleaning Dry Chemical Residue

Dry chemical extinguishers are the most common culprits for messy residue. The powder is designed to smother flames but can stick to surfaces. Here’s how to tackle it.

Step 1: Vacuuming the Loose Powder

Start by using a vacuum cleaner with a HEPA filter. This is essential to capture the fine particles and prevent them from becoming airborne. Gently vacuum all affected surfaces. Avoid vigorous scrubbing at this stage, as it can push the powder deeper into carpets or upholstery. Many household vacuums aren’t equipped for this, so specialized equipment might be needed.

Step 2: Wiping Down Surfaces

Once the bulk of the powder is removed, you’ll need to wipe down surfaces. For hard, non-porous surfaces like walls, furniture, or floors, a damp cloth or sponge works well. Use a solution of mild dish soap and water. For more sensitive materials or stubborn residue, you might need a specialized cleaning agent. Always test any cleaning solution in an inconspicuous area first.

Step 4: Rinsing and Drying

After cleaning, rinse the surfaces thoroughly with clean water. This removes any remaining cleaning solution and residue. Then, dry the area completely. Dampness can lead to mold or mildew growth. Use fans and dehumidifiers to speed up the drying process. Proper drying is as important as the cleaning itself.

What is the main danger of fire extinguisher residue?

The main dangers include respiratory irritation, skin and eye irritation, and potential damage to surfaces if the residue is left unaddressed for too long. Some residues can be corrosive.

Can I use a regular vacuum cleaner for fire extinguisher powder?

It’s best to use a vacuum with a HEPA filter. Regular vacuums can expel fine particles back into the air, worsening the problem and posing a health risk. They can also be damaged by the fine powder.

How long does it take for fire extinguisher residue to cause damage?

The time frame varies depending on the type of residue and the surface. Dry chemical residues can become corrosive over time, especially in humid conditions, potentially causing etching or staining within days or weeks. Acting fast minimizes the risk of permanent damage.
